On Sat, 2002-09-14 at 19:53, Jarno Paananen wrote:
> Hi,
>
> the two modules mentioned export symbols but are not mentioned in
> export-objs in Makefile and thus give errors. Patch attached.
>
> // Jarno
>
> --- net/ipv4/netfilter/Makefile.bak 2002-09-14 19:50:38.000000000 +0300
> +++ net/ipv4/netfilter/Makefile 2002-09-14 19:51:28.000000000 +0300
> @@ -9,7 +9,7 @@
>
> O_TARGET := netfilter.o
>
> -export-objs = ip_conntrack_standalone.o ip_fw_compat.o ip_nat_standalone.o ip_tables.o arp_tables.o
> +export-objs = ip_conntrack_standalone.o ip_fw_compat.o ip_nat_standalone.o ip_tables.o arp_tables.o ip_conntrack_ftp.o ip_conntrack_irc.o
>
> # Multipart objects.
> list-multi := ip_conntrack.o iptable_nat.o ipfwadm.o ipchains.o

Did you see this part starting at row 34?

# connection tracking helpers
obj-$(CONFIG_IP_NF_FTP) += ip_conntrack_ftp.o
ifdef CONFIG_IP_NF_NAT_FTP
        export-objs += ip_conntrack_ftp.o
endif

obj-$(CONFIG_IP_NF_IRC) += ip_conntrack_irc.o
ifdef CONFIG_IP_NF_NAT_IRC
        export-objs += ip_conntrack_irc.o
endif

but maybe the ifdefs shouldn't use the NAT define...
I don't think I've compiled without NAT support...
